Career

Rahman became a lawyer of the Districts Court on 26 November 1989. On 29 May 1990, Rahman became a lawyer of the High Court Division of Bangladesh Supreme Court. Rahman became a lawyer of the Appellate Division of the Bangladesh Supreme Court on 25 October 2001. On 23 August 2004, Rahman was appointed an additional judge of the High Court Division of Bangladesh Supreme Court. Rahman was made a permanent judge of the High Court Division on 23 August 2006.
